Sun Village, CA (July 13, 2025) – One person lost their life in a two-car crash that happened late Saturday morning, July 12, in Sun Village.
According to the California Highway Patrol, the crash took place at about 11:01 a.m. at the intersection of East Palmdale Boulevard and 120th Street East. A gray Ford Mustang and a blue GMC SUV were both involved.
Officials said one person was trapped inside one of the vehicles. Emergency crews arrived shortly after the crash and tried to help, but the person was pronounced dead at the scene. Their name has not yet been shared, as officials are waiting to notify the family.
The exact cause of the crash is still unclear. Investigators spent several hours at the scene. The road was closed as crews worked to remove the vehicles and gather evidence.
